About

Longplay turns your Apple Music library into a wall of album artwork and asks you to listen the way records were meant to be heard: whole albums, front to back. Its Negligence Sorting surfaces favourites you have not played in ages, Smart Collections organise the wall by genre or rating automatically, and Album Purity Mode keeps playback strictly sequential.

Indie developer Adrian Schoenig brought Longplay to the Mac on 15 July 2025, after years as a beloved iOS app, adding a dedicated mini player, AppleScript support, more than 25 Shortcuts actions and, unusually, a built-in MCP server so AI assistants like Claude can browse and play your collection. The Mac version is a one-time $29.99 purchase on the Mac App Store, with collections synced across devices via iCloud.
